L’Arche Highland is based in Inverness, Scotland, the UK’s most northerly and fastest growing city.

Inverness is set on the River Ness, which flows from the famous Loch Ness and it known as the ‘Capital of the Highlands’. We are lucky to be surrounded by some of the most majestic scenery in the UK and to have salmon swimming through our city centre and deer running through our gardens.

Our Community is the second oldest L’Arche Community in the UK as it was established in 1975. We were founded by Therese Vanier, a distinguished doctor and early protagonist of the hospice movement as well as Elizabeth Buckley as the first Community Leader.

L’Arche was fortunate enough to be gifted Braerannoch, the beautiful home of William Birnie, the Director of the local Glen Mhor and Glenalbyn whiskey distilleries, by his daughter Jean Graham. Our founding Core Members, Ian Cameron; Raymond MacDonald; Pat Cameron and Doreen Fraser, moved into Braerannoch directly from Craig Phadrig Hospital in Inverness. In the early days the Community was supported by Lady Maud Baillie of Dochfour, Lady Rosie Lovat as well as Malcolm and Kathy Fraser of Reelig.

Today, L’Arche Highland is a large and vibrant Community well integrated into the life of Inverness.
